Eradicating Human Trafficking with Polaris Project

The crucial Polaris Project, accessible at the Polaris Project website, stands as a leading organization dedicated to abolishing human trafficking and modern slavery. Via their multifaceted strategy, they deliver a range of assistance including the National Human Trafficking Hotline, the BeFree platform, and groundbreaking research. Their work center on spotting victims, helping survivors, and pursuing traffickers liable. Fighting Human Slavery with The Salvation Assistance

The Salvation Army is a vital resource in the national fight against human modern-day servitude. Their dedicated programs, as outlined on their website ([https://www.salvationarmyusa.org/usn/home/social-services/human-trafficking/](https://www.salvationarmyusa.org/usn/home/social-services/human-trafficking/)), offer essential support to individuals and actively work to stop this horrific crime. From providing safe shelter and therapy to facilitating recovery and legal assistance, the Salvation comprehensive method demonstrates a deep commitment to reclaiming lives and bringing accountability to those who have been exploited.
